http://buletinonline.net/http://buletinonline.net/v7/wp-content/uploads/2011/02/TGHAlancartelukpasu.jpgBESUT, March 20 (Bernama) — PAS president Datuk Seri Abdul Hadi Awang is confident of the opposition’s chances at Sarawak’s 10th state election.

“It is not impossible for voters to go for change. This is based on result of Sibu by-election in May last year which DAP won, he said after giving a talk at Sungai Jerteh here today.

Sarawak Chief Minister Tan Sri Abdul Taib Mahmud yesterday announced that the Sarawak State Legislative Assembly will be dissolved tomorrow.

PKR deputy president Azmin Ali and DAP deputy chairman Dr Tan Seng Giaw were also present at the talk.

Asked about his sister Ummi Hafilda’s claim that he was blinded by sweet promises of PKR adviser Datuk Seri Anwar Ibrahim, he said: “The opposition is focused in our struggle and it is up to our opponent to use such tactic.”
